Comprehending the TELC Certificate
TELC supplies language tests throughout several languages, consisting of German, English, French, Spanish, and Italian. These assessments are created for different levels of proficiency, lined up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Certificates range from A1 (beginner) to C2 (skilled), dealing with a wide audience, including trainees, professionals, and immigrants.

How to Verify a TELC Certificate
The confirmation of a TELC certificate can be a straightforward procedure if one knows the best actions. Here is a structured technique:
Check the Certificate Details:
Examine for any evident indications of alteration.Verify the prospect's name, level of the exam, and date of problem.
Contact TELC:
To confirm credibility, contact TELC directly. They use confirmation services for companies and individuals.Utilize contact information from the official TELC website to avoid any deceptive entities.
Utilize the Online Verification Tool:
TELC supplies an online verification system for companies and institutions.Get in the prospect's details, including their certificate number and goethe zertifikat personal recognition details.The system will show whether the certificate is legitimate.
Seek Advice From the Examination Center:
